Output bf8eb6961afec57ac28c5b53b5906959350c457db149002f9faf45c22824cb86:3

value
24977664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ba7514df63d5c92deff56b975c2d31c1ef6c010f2ee6f56cb3f8c016f8ef1da
address
tb1pdwn4zn0k84wf9hhl26uhtsknrs00dsqs7thx74kt87xqzmuw78dqaa7xnh
transaction
bf8eb6961afec57ac28c5b53b5906959350c457db149002f9faf45c22824cb86
confirmations
36584
spent
true